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7414479 918597797 534
57748112458 1531752
57748112458 1531752
125221 1973370 89 23 67
All about undefined
Interested in learning more?
57748112458 1531752
125221 1973370 89 23 67
See more
46552466145 14
702789980 81661 44810
See more
901901364 54440434 894146773
94197704905 549093673 4011 59
See more